Mesa (master): ac/nir, radv, radeonsi: Switch to using ac_shader_args
GitLab Mirror
gitlab-mirror at kemper.freedesktop.org
Mon Nov 25 13:46:45 UTC 2019
Module: Mesa
Branch: master
Commit: 3b143369a55d1b79f7db14dda587e18f6b27c975
UR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=3b143369a55d1b79f7db14dda587e18f6b27c975
Author: Connor Abbott <cwabbott0 at gmail.com>
Date: Mon Nov 11 12:50:12 2019 +0100
ac/nir, radv, radeonsi: Switch to using ac_shader_args
Reviewed-by: Samuel Pitoiset <samuel.pitoiset at gmail.com>
Acked-by: Marek Olšák <marek.olsak at amd.com>
---
src/amd/llvm/ac_nir_to_llvm.c | 95 +-
src/amd/llvm/ac_nir_to_llvm.h | 3 +-
src/amd/llvm/ac_shader_abi.h | 44 +-
src/amd/vulkan/meson.build | 1 +
src/amd/vulkan/radv_nir_to_llvm.c | 1407 ++++++++++----------
src/amd/vulkan/radv_shader_args.h | 76 ++
src/gallium/drivers/radeonsi/gfx10_shader_ngg.c | 47 +-
.../drivers/radeonsi/si_compute_prim_discard.c | 111 +-
src/gallium/drivers/radeonsi/si_shader.c | 1143 ++++++++--------
src/gallium/drivers/radeonsi/si_shader_internal.h | 106 +-
src/gallium/drivers/radeonsi/si_shader_nir.c | 19 +-
src/gallium/drivers/radeonsi/si_shader_tgsi_mem.c | 19 +-
.../drivers/radeonsi/si_shader_tgsi_setup.c | 39 +-
13 files changed, 1557 insertions(+), 1553 deletions(-)
Diff: http://cgit.freedesktop.org/mesa/mesa/diff/?id=3b143369a55d1b79f7db14dda587e18f6b27c975
More information about the mesa-commit
mailing list